import functools
from typing import Awaitable, Callable, ParamSpec, TypeVar
import anyio
from anyio import to_thread
T_ParamSpec = ParamSpec("T_ParamSpec")
T_Retval = TypeVar("T_Retval")
def function_has_argument(function: Callable, arg_name: str) -> bool:
"""Helper function to check if a function has a specific argument."""
import inspect
signature = inspect.signature(function)
return arg_name in signature.parameters
def asyncify(
function: Callable[T_ParamSpec, T_Retval],
*,
cancellable: bool = False,
limiter: anyio.CapacityLimiter | None = None,
) -> Callable[T_ParamSpec, Awaitable[T_Retval]]:
"""
Take a blocking function and create an async one that receives the same
positional and keyword arguments, and that when called, calls the original function
in a worker thread using `anyio.to_thread.run_sync()`.
If the `cancellable` option is enabled and the task waiting for its completion is
cancelled, the thread will still run its course but its return value (or any raised
exception) will be ignored.
## Arguments
- `function`: a blocking regular callable (e.g. a function)
- `cancellable`: `True` to allow cancellation of the operation
- `limiter`: capacity limiter to use to limit the total amount of threads running
(if omitted, the default limiter is used)
## Return
An async function that takes the same positional and keyword arguments as the
original one, that when called runs the same original function in a thread worker
and returns the result.
"""
async def wrapper(
*args: T_ParamSpec.args, **kwargs: T_ParamSpec.kwargs
) -> T_Retval:
partial_f = functools.partial(function, *args, **kwargs)
# In `v4.1.0` anyio added the `abandon_on_cancel` argument and deprecated the old
# `cancellable` argument, so we need to use the new `abandon_on_cancel` to avoid
# surfacing deprecation warnings.
if function_has_argument(anyio.to_thread.run_sync, "abandon_on_cancel"):
return await anyio.to_thread.run_sync(
partial_f,
abandon_on_cancel=cancellable,
limiter=limiter,
)
return await anyio.to_thread.run_sync(
partial_f,
cancellable=cancellable,
limiter=limiter,
)
return wrapper
